What is IASME Cyber Baseline certification?

The IASME Cyber Baseline aligns with several established international cyber hygiene standards and best practices. Historically, there has been no way of demonstrating compliance with these standards due to the absence of assessments and certification protocols.

The scheme is an essential first step for many organisations outside the UK to prove that they are serious about cyber security.


The eight fundamental themes of IASME Cyber Baseline

The IASME Cyber Baseline scheme paves the way for organisations of all sizes and across diverse sectors to embark on their cyber security by implementing straightforward cyber security measures across eight fundamental themes.

  • Organisation
  • Assets
  • Secure architecture
  • People
  • Managing access
  • Technical intrusion
  • Back-up and restore
  • Resilience

How does the IASME Cyber Baseline certification work?

The IASME Cyber Baseline helps organisations attain and demonstrate a robust level of information security within a practical budget.

You will receive login details to access the assessment platform to enable you to begin your certification. You will have six months to complete your assessment before your account is archived.

The certification is renewable annually.

As a Certifying Body for IASME, we welcome the news that IAMSE has recently partnered with Bermuda’s Office of the Privacy Commissioner (PrivCom) to deliver the IASME Cyber Assurance standard, which allows organisations to demonstrate their compliance to PIPA (Personal Information Protection Act) from January 1st, 2025. An accepted way to meet this requirement is to get certified to IASME Cyber Baseline and then become certified to IASME Cyber Assurance Level 1.
